Subject: Seaborg jobs to be boosted at 768+ processors
Author: Francesca Verdier <fverdier_at_lbl.gov>
Date: 2006-01-17 12:16:44
Dear Seaborg users, Effective next Tuesday, January 24, regular priority jobs running on 768+ processors (48+ nodes) will continue to receive a scheduling boost. Regular priority jobs running on 32-47 nodes will no longer be boosted; they will have the same scheduling priority as 1-31 node jobs. A reminder that regular priority jobs running on 48+ nodes receive a 25% discount. NERSC encourages users to scale their codes to effectively run on 48+ nodes.
